Zenith

In a future Solar System inhabited by Humans, Robots and Animods, factions compete for control of energy-rich worlds powered by Zenithium. Players place and manipulate colored Influence discs across five planets — Mercury, Venus, Earth, Mars and Jupiter — to sway the senate. Play centers on acquiring and arranging Influence to meet one of three instant-win conditions: collecting three discs on the same planet, four discs on four different planets, or five discs in total. The first player to satisfy any of these conditions ends the game immediately.

Regelspørgsmål

Besvaret ud fra regelbogen af Ludoyas regelassistent.

How do Influence discs move — can I put a disc anywhere on the track when I gain Influence?

When you gain an Influence, move the corresponding planet’s Influence disc exactly 1 space toward your control zone; if it reaches your control zone you gain that disc (Rulebook, p.6). Note that any extra movement beyond the control zone is lost (Rulebook, p.6).

When I recruit an Agent, do I resolve its effects right away — and can the card I just played target itself?

Resolve Recruit in order: place the card, pay its cost (reduced by stacked cards), then apply its effects left-to-right — so the card’s effects can target the just-played card (Rulebook, p.7; FAQ, p.11).

How exactly do I develop a Technology and when do Level 2 bonuses and row bonuses apply?

To develop you discard a matching-faction card, pay the Zenithium cost of the next level, move your tech marker up, and apply the new level’s effect in addition to earlier levels (Rulebook, p.8). The first player to a Level 2 track gains and immediately applies that track’s Bonus token before lower-level effects, and completing all three Level 1/2/3 tracks grants the corresponding row bonus of 1/2/3 Influence (Rulebook, p.8).

What does the Leader badge do, and how do I take or flip it?

Take the Become the Leader action by discarding a faction card to gain the Leader badge plus the faction-specific benefit (Robot: +1 Zenithium, Human: +3 Credits, Animod: mobilize 2) (Rulebook, p.9). When you take the badge from an opponent it goes to Silver (5-card hand), flipping it to Gold increases your hand limit to 6; hand refill at end of turn respects your current badge (Rulebook, p.9).

When does the game end and what are the victory conditions I should watch for?

The game ends immediately when a player meets one of three victory conditions: Absolute (gain 3 discs from the same planet), Democratic (gain 4 discs from strictly different planets), or Popular (gain 5 discs total) (Rulebook, p.1), and play stops as soon as one is satisfied (Rulebook, p.9).
